This is the Virgin River in Zion National Park, Utah.  I mentioned this a few posts ago, but we camped here for three nights during our trip out west.  There were no bathrooms, so our only method of bathing was to hop in the river.  The average daytime temperature during our time in the park was over 100 degrees Fahrenheit, however, the water temperature was 55 degrees.  Refreshing to say the least.  Our little spot by the river was one of the most beautiful I've ever seen.
